Megger Service Excellence, located in Dover, is seeking a motivated Planner/Buyer for a 9-month fixed-term contract with potential for permanence. This role involves overseeing procurement tasks, managing vendor relationships, and ensuring supply continuity.

Candidates should have at least 2 years of manufacturing buying experience, strong ERP/MRP system knowledge, especially with SAP, and excellent communication skills.

The position follows a hybrid working model, combining on-site and remote work opportunities.

Get Involved in Local Procurement Meetups

Join local procurement and purchasing groups on platforms like Meetup or Eventbrite. These gatherings are great for networking with industry professionals, sharing insights, and potentially hearing about temporary roles that might not be widely advertised!

Seasonal Hiring Cycles are Your Friend!

Keep an eye on seasonal trends in procurement, as many companies ramp up hiring during certain times of the year – especially around end-of-financial-year periods when budgets are being utilised. Be proactive and reach out to companies directly during these windows.

Leverage Online Platforms for Temporary Roles

Don’t forget to browse specific job boards dedicated to temporary positions, such as Reed or Indeed. You can filter your search for procurement roles and set up alerts for when new jobs pop up, so you can apply immediately!

Showcase Your Skills on Professional Networks

Create short case studies or posts on LinkedIn showcasing your procurement experience or interesting projects you've tackled. This not only builds your visibility but can also attract recruiters looking for temporary talent like you!

How to prepare for a job interview at Megger Service Excellence

Know Your Procurement Basics

Brush up on key procurement concepts and terms, like 'total cost of ownership' and 'supplier relationships'. We want to impress them with our knowledge! Being able to talk fluently about relevant techniques and tools specific to the procurement field will definitely lend credibility.

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ions

In a purchasing role, you might get thrown some real-world scenarios to assess how you’d handle supplier negotiations or cost-saving strategies. Be ready to demonstrate your problem-solving skills! Practising how you'd tackle these situations in advance will help us shine during the interview.

Highlight Your Flexibility and Adaptability

Since it’s a temporary role, emphasise how you can quickly adapt to new processes and environments. Share examples of past experiences where you’ve tackled new challenges with ease, showing they can rely on us to hit the ground running and contribute immediately!

Show Off Your Tech Savvy

Being well-versed in procurement software like SAP or Coupa can set us apart from other candidates. If you've got experience with these tools, be sure to mention it! Having a handle on data analysis and reporting will also demonstrate our capability to leverage technology effectively in procurement.
